Hyderabad, October 25
In a tragic incident, a drunk son beheaded his 65-year-old mother after she refused to give him money to buy liquor. The incident came to light yesterday morning. P Ramulu, 45, has been arrested.
Villagers found the headless body of Chandramma inside the house and alerted the police. Kurumurthy, the elder son, suspected his younger brother, who was used to alcoholic misbehaviour. Upon search, the severed head of the old woman was found in a water tank near the house.
The police have recovered a sickle used in the crime.
Kollapur Circle Inspector Venkat Reddy, the investigating officer, said, “He (Ramulu) was addicted to alcohol and had been harassing his mother daily. In the wee hours, he killed and beheaded her. We have registered a case on the complaint of the victim’s elder son.”
This is the second such incident in the state. Earlier, a woman’s husband had beheaded her in Anantasagar village of Sangareddy over suspicion of an extramarital affair.
